evilfusion Posted January 19, 2012 Report Share Posted January 19, 2012 No. Botanical Lion cannot be Swapped due to its effect. You cannot activate Creature Swap if it is the only monster you control, and if it becomes your only monster before resolution, it will fizzle as both players are incapable of swapping a monster. Darj Posted January 19, 2012 Report Share Posted January 19, 2012 This is tricky, so I'll just tell you how to know when a card DOESN'T target. -When it deals with variable values (Smashing Ground does not target because it kills the monster with the most defense, which can be changed at any time)--Note: I am honestly not sure how to word this, so if anyone can say it better, please do-When it does not specify a specific number of targets (Stratos kills Spells and Traps equal to the number of HEROs on your field. Since the field can change before resolution it does not target.)--Note: Cards like Junk Destroyer do target because the number of targets (or the number of non-tuners) is decided before the effect activates)-When the effect selects a card in the hand or deck.--Note: This matters even if the card effects the field as well, like Trishula. If the card does not do any of the above, it targets. I may have missed some though, so if you have anything I haven't exactly covered, let me know. It looks like you covered everything. Ieyasu Tokugawa Posted January 20, 2012 Report Share Posted January 20, 2012 If Archlord Kristya is on the field, can I special summon in a way that removes Kristya from the field? For example, can I use my opponent's Kristya for Lava Golem, Super Polymerization, or Ninjitsu Art of Super Transformation?No. Cards like Kristya or Fossil Dyna do not allow you to even attempt to Special Summon, even if that Summon would removed the preventer from the field. evilfusion Posted January 22, 2012 Report Share Posted January 22, 2012 If my witch of the black forest attacks my opponent's witch of the black forest and we both add exodia the forbidden one to our hand to complete. Is it a draw or what? The effects will chain together. Turn Player's Witch will be Chain Link 1, and the opponent's will be Chain Link 2. Chains resolves backwards. Chain Link 2: Opponent adds "Exodia the Forbidden One" to their hand, completing the set.Win Conditions are checked between Chain Links. Opponent has Exodia the Forbidden One set in hand. Opponent wins duel.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
